Chesterfield Countys Utilities Department is seeking a Utility Plant Mechanic to perform operation, inspection, and maintenance of mechanical and electrical equipment in wastewater pump station facilities. Perform general housekeeping duties. Have the ability to record and translate data from flow recorders. Have the ability to generate and complete work orders in the departments work management computer system. Mandatory on call and overtime required. Perform other work as required.This position is part of an approved Career Development Plan (CDP) and offers career progression opportunities and salary incentives, as funding permits, based on performance, qualifications, and experience.
Successful candidate will possess a
high school diploma or equivalent. Have basic electrical knowledge and knowledge of pumps, motors, and motor controllers. Three years' experience in the operation and maintenance of Wastewater Pump Stations and related equipment or equivalent combination of training and experience; lifting of heavy equipment required. Have basic computer skills with the ability to collect and enter data effectively into the departments work management system. Lifting up to 50 pounds required. Commercial Driver's License (CDL) Class "A" with Tanker endorsement required or must have ability to obtain within one year of employment.Current valid drivers license and good driving record required. Based on the Virginia DMV point system, record must not reflect a total of six or more demerit points within the twenty-four months preceding the anticipated hire date, or one major violation of six demerit points within the preceding thirty-six months. Out of state driving records must be obtained by applicant and presented at time of interview. Records must reflect at least three years of history and be dated within thirty days of interview date. This position is a federally regulated DOT position and is subject to random drug testing and alcohol testing. The use of medical marijuana for this position is prohibited.Pre-employment drug testing, FBI criminal background check and education/degree verification required.
